Koster, Martha J. was born on December 17, 1946 in New Haven.

Smith College (Bachelor of Arts, with distinction, 1968). University of Chicago. Boston University (Juris Doctor, cum laude, 1971).
Worked at Mintz, Levin, Cohn, Ferris, Glovsky and Popeo, P.C. (Boston, MA) specializing in General Practice. Admitted to the bar, 1971, Mass. 1979, United States. Supreme Court. Phi Beta Kappa. First Group Scholar.
Recipient, Melvin Bigelow Scholarship Award. Member: Women's Bar Association. ML Strategies and ML Global are wholly-owned consulting affiliates of Mintz Levin.
